I think first of all, these sytems aren’t perfect. For the price, they do pretty well in my opinion. Also, are your percentage figures a blend of night time and day time numbers? Another factor is how an object moves toward the camera. Are your objects always moving towards the camera in the same manner? These camera, just like motion based security lights, are more sensitive to motion moving across their field of view as opposed to straight towards them. Lighting is another factor, A bit of ambient light helps to trigger motion alert and recording as the camera does not have to rely on PIR sensors.
